Expanding Flavor Variety
Classic frozen desserts are traditionally dairy-based, but vegan ice creams use plant-based alternatives like almond milk, oat milk, or coconut milk. These bases create unique textures and flavor profiles. Innovative combinations—such as tropical fruit with coconut or rich chocolate blended with cashew—elevate the vegan dessert experience.

Health Considerations
Health seekers often opt for plant-based desserts as a lighter indulgence. Many vegan options are lower in saturated fat and cholesterol than dairy-based treats, supporting heart health and weight management. Nuts, fruits, and natural sweeteners provide essential nutrients, fiber, and energy, rather than empty calories, making each bite both satisfying and nourishing.
Texture and Creaminess
For lovers of frozen treats, mouthfeel really matters. Many people assume only dairy can produce that rich, creamy texture, but vegan recipes prove otherwise. Ingredients like coconut cream or blended cashews create a thick, silky texture that surprises many first-time tasters with how closely it resembles traditional ice cream.

Allergy-Friendly Choices
Traditional dairy desserts can be off-limits for people with certain food allergies or sensitivities. Vegan frozen treats avoid animal by-products and are often free from common allergens, such as milk—and sometimes even tree nuts. This makes it easier for everyone to enjoy dessert without worry, offering safer, easy-to-share options.

Sustainability Matters
Many purchasing decisions today are shaped by environmental concerns. Compared to plant-based alternatives, dairy farming requires more land, water, and energy. Vegan desserts typically have a smaller environmental footprint, making them an appealing choice for eco-conscious consumers who want indulgence aligned with sustainable, planet-friendly lifestyles and responsible food choices.
